While the established idea of a kitchen triangle is tried and tested, there are smaller items and units that also require convenient design at the layout stage. “Cooking elaborate meals from scratch versus prepping simpler means less often should influence the design, as will the number of people who cook together,” comments homes journalist Sarah Warwick. Although sometimes dismissed as an unfortunately, awkward layout, this option is actually great for keen cooks , and helps to maximise storage in a limited area. Galley kitchens are usually found in long, narrow rooms, while parallel kitchens can be found in larger, more open-plan kitchens.
